Neenah, WI, known as "The Paper City," is a vibrant community on the banks of Lake Winnebago. With a population of over 27,000, Neenah has a rich industrial history, highlighted by its historic paper mills. The city is renowned for its stunning waterfront homes, many of which offer private docks and panoramic views of the lake. These homes reflect the area's past wealth from the paper industry. Neenah's downtown area features historic homes alongside ranch-style and bungalow residences, with new constructions emerging on the outskirts. The city has over 350 acres of parks, including Kimberly Point Park, where the Neenah Lighthouse stands as a historic landmark. Attractions such as the Bergstrom-Mahler Museum of Glass, with its unique paperweight collection, add cultural depth to the area. Downtown Neenah offers a walkable strip filled with galleries, boutiques, and farm-to-table dining options, including the acclaimed Town Council Kitchen & Bar. Neenah Joint School District is highly rated, providing quality education with vocational training opportunities. Crime rates have decreased significantly since 2017, with areas safer than the national average. The city is conveniently located near Appleton and Oshkosh, with access to I-41 for commuters. Neenah's community spirit is evident in events like A Very Neenah Christmas and CommunityFest, fostering a lively and engaging atmosphere for residents.
